Burton Barr Central Library will host an exhibition of work by T.M. Noël, titled 'Everyone Could Use a Hero," at the library's @Central Gallery.

Rendering the images of Martin Luther King, Jr., Bob Marley, Jimi Hendrix, Malcolm X and Tupac Shakur in charcoal, graphite and oil paint, Noël explores 'heroes' in the mainstream, urban environments and historical struggles. Using a style infused with scribbles and scratches, Noël invokes a feeling that the subject is studying the viewer as the viewer studies the work.
